5 5 Related Works (1/3) Web-based personal storage systems Two entities are involved Data supplier uploads encrypted data, then searches data containing keywords Song et al. [13] In 2000, they first suggest efficient and provably secure keyword search scheme by block cipher Goh[8] Goh suggested a secure search scheme using a Bloom filter Chang and Mitzenmacher[6] They suggested a practical keyword search protocol in terms of communication and storage overheads.

6 6 Related Works (2/3) Conjunctive keyword search Golle et al.’s work [7] They suggested two conjunctive keyword search protocols enabling users to search conjunctively. Golle I Communication and storage costs It requires O(n) Golle II Unverifiable computational assumption Is it really secure ?
